Thanks for your great explanation!! I'm wondering if there is a way to show '% of sales ' for each account in column? The change of '% of sales ' is quite important to the analysis in ROS wise as well as the analysis in absolute amount change.
Very good point, yes, you are able to add your custom columns by adding your measure under into the Values placeholder bucket (you can have up to 20 such Values). More can be found at: help.zebrabi.com/article/62-adding-custom-calculated-columns-to-zebra-bi-tables
